2012-03-01 184 views
1

所有,用故事板,UISplitViewController和多個細節視圖(MultipleDetailViews用故事板)

它不是這樣的:Science At Hand - Adventures in UISplitViewController。這真的來自UITabBarController而不是Master中的單元格。

比方說,我想創建一個SplitViewController。在左側,我在同一個列表中有不同類型的單元格(它不會在Apple Store上,所以我不在乎它是否是Apple iOk)。對於每種不同的細胞類型,我都希望有一個不同的DetailView控制器。細胞類型A顯示DetailView A,細胞類型B顯示DetailView B.

  1. 如何更新SplitViewController子視圖以移動detailviews?
  2. 我可以只將導航控制器的細節,然後添加viewControllers?使用基於seque名稱的get或從storyboard獲取視圖?
  3. 一些其他的,真的很明顯的方式,我只是想念。

獎勵積分,我想一個辦法來檢測我要離開一個的DetailView(保存),並移動到不同的DetailView(不同的細胞類型按鈕被按下)

+0

可能出現[Splitview with multiple detail views using storyboarding。看到一個示例/教程?](http://stackoverflow.com/questions/7993168/splitview-with-multiple-detail-views-using-storyboarding-seen-an-example-tutori) – jrc 2015-10-14 22:07:32

回答

3

原來這很簡單。

如果你做了顯而易見的事情(誰會想到?)它工作得很好。我創建了我的不同的細胞視圖。每個單元格視圖都有一個鏈接,我只鏈接到一系列視圖控制器。我只需要改變seque,這是一個替換,它把視圖放到細節視圖中。

+2

嘿,你可以示例代碼,你可以與我們分享 – Doz 2012-04-20 01:55:08

+0

喲,該代碼(甚至僞)的任何機會成爲可用?謝謝! – gdubs 2013-02-06 06:21:50

0

我做這個樣本中的GitHub

https://github.com/AlfonsoMoreno/MultipleDetailView

MasterViewController是的UITableViewController

FirstDetailViewController是UIViewController的 SecondDetailViewController是的UITableViewController

您可以添加更多的意見!

請觀看MultipleDetailViewManager class !!!